How to fill out release and waiver of

How to fill out release and waiver of:
01
Obtain the appropriate form: Begin by obtaining the release and waiver of form from the relevant source. This may be from an organization, event, or legal entity that requires participants or attendees to sign this document.
02
Read the form thoroughly: Carefully read through the entire document to understand its purpose and the rights and responsibilities you are agreeing to waive. Pay close attention to any specific instructions or requirements mentioned.
03
Provide personal information: Fill out the form by providing your personal information, including your full name, address, contact details, and any other required information. Make sure all the information you provide is accurate and up to date.
04
Identify the purpose of the release: Clearly state the purpose for which the release and waiver of is being filled out. This is typically described in the introductory section of the form. For example, if you are participating in a physical activity or attending an event, mention the name and nature of the activity/event.
05
Release of liability: Declare that you understand and accept the risks involved in the activity/event and agree to release the organizers, sponsors, and any affiliated individuals from any and all liabilities, claims, or damages that may arise.
06
Waiver of rights: Acknowledge that you are waiving certain legal rights by signing the release and waiver of. It is important to read this section thoroughly to understand the specific rights you are giving up, such as the right to sue or seek compensation for injuries or losses.
07
Signature and date: Sign the release and waiver of form after reading and understanding all its contents. Ensure that you sign in the designated space and include the current date.
Who needs release and waiver of:
01
Individuals participating in physical activities: Whether it's sports, adventure activities, or fitness programs, individuals engaging in physical activities may be required to sign a release and waiver of to waive certain legal rights and assume responsibility for any potential risks.
02
Event attendees: Attendees of events such as concerts, festivals, or exhibitions may be required to sign a release and waiver of to hold the event organizers harmless from any liability for personal injuries, property damage, or other potential claims that may arise during the event.
03
Volunteers: Organizations or non-profit entities that rely on volunteers may request them to fill out release and waiver of forms. This ensures that volunteers understand the potential risks associated with their tasks and hold the organization harmless from any liability.
04
Participants in organized tours or trips: Individuals participating in organized tours, trips, or excursions may require signing a release and waiver of to protect the organizers from any legal claims in case of accidents, injuries, or unexpected events during the trip.
05
Participants in recreational or educational programs: Individuals participating in recreational or educational programs, such as workshops, classes, or seminars, may be required to sign a release and waiver of to acknowledge and assume responsibility for any risks associated with the program.
Note: The need for a release and waiver of may vary depending on the specific circumstances, regulations, and legal requirements of different activities and organizations. It is always advisable to review and understand the contents of the form before signing.
